Transaction 5c17976720f2d63e77feb2154ad4a47c70a85c46115f766f7d8cd19b4de88d7a

1 Input
2 Outputs
  • 5c17976720f2d63e77feb2154ad4a47c70a85c46115f766f7d8cd19b4de88d7a:0
  • value  663719
    address  38mLNbzSsXRBASTSFVXCM4KDVCpv3URbfg
  • 5c17976720f2d63e77feb2154ad4a47c70a85c46115f766f7d8cd19b4de88d7a:1
  • value  182115698
    address  1F2RogJYfWgAP1A6LwpdBKU515RErhYoC4